01: /*
02: * Copyright 2005 Sun Microsystems, Inc. All
03: * rights reserved. Use of this product is subject
04: * to license terms. Federal Acquisitions:
05: * Commercial Software -- Government Users
06: * Subject to Standard License Terms and
07: * Conditions.
08: *
09: * Sun, Sun Microsystems, the Sun logo, and Sun ONE
10: * are trademarks or registered trademarks of Sun Microsystems,
11: * Inc. in the United States and other countries.
12: */
13:
14: package com.sun.portal.wsrp.common.registry.ebxml;
15:
16: public interface JESRegistryConstants {
17:
18: //Properties used for fetching values from configuration or user input.
19: public static final String KEY_STORE_TYPE = "registry.keystoretype";
20: public static final String KEY_STORE_PASSWD = "registry.keystorepassword";
21: public static final String KEY_STORE_LOCATION = "registry.keystorelocation";
22: public static final String KEY_PASSWD = "registry.keypassword";
23: public static final String KEY_STORE_ALIAS = "registry.keystorealias";
24:
25: public static final String QUERY_URL = "registry.queryurl";
26: public static final String PUBLISH_URL = "registry.publishurl";
27: public static final String PROXY_HOST = "http.proxy.host";
28: public static final String PROXY_PORT = "http.proxy.port";
29: public static final String PROXY_USER = "http.proxy.user";
30: public static final String PROXY_PASSWD = "http.proxy.password";
31: public static final String JAXR_EBXML_KEYSTORE_LOCATION = "jaxr-ebxml.security.keystore";
32: public static final String JAXR_EBXML_KEYSTORE_PASSWD = "jaxr-ebxml.security.storepass";
33: public static final String WSRP_V1_DESC = "wsrp.v1.url.description";
34: public static final String WSRP_V1_SPEC_NAME = "wsrp.v1.spec.name";
35: public static final String WSRP_VI_SPEC_DESC = "wsrp.v1.spec.description";
36: public static final String WSRP_PRODUCER_URL_DESC = "wsrp.producer.url.sd.description";
37:
38: //Properties used by the JAXR to specify configuration settings
39: public static final String JAXR_QUERY_URL_STRING = "javax.xml.registry.queryManagerURL";
40: public static final String JAXR_PUBLISH_URL_STRING = "javax.xml.registry.lifeCycleManagerURL";
41:
42: //ebXML URN Strings defined in the specification
43: public static final String EBXML_WSRP_V1_CONCEPT_STR = "urn:oasis:names:tc:wsrp:pfb:ebxml:registry:classificationScheme:WSRPVersion:10";
44: public static final String EBXML_WSRP_PRODUCER_CONCEPT_STR = "urn:oasis:names:tc:wsrp:pfb:ebxml:registry:objectType:Producer";
45: public static final String EBXML_WSRP_PORTLET_CONCEPT_STR = "urn:oasis:names:tc:wsrp:pfb:ebxml:registry:objectType:Portlet";
46:
47: public static final String OASIS_WSRP_V1_SPEC_URL = "http://www.oasis-open.org/committees/wsrp/specifications/version1/wsrp_v1_types.xsd";
48:
49: public static final String EBXML_WSRP_PRODUCER_REQUIRES_REGISTRATION = "urn:oasis:names:tc:wsrp:ServiceDescription:requiresRegistration";
50: public static final String EBXML_WSRP_PRODUCER_REQUIRES_INIT_COOKIE = "urn:oasis:names:tc:wsrp:ServiceDescription:requiresInitCookie";
51: public static final String EBXML_WSRP_PORTLET_HANDLE = "urn:oasis:names:tc:wsrp:PortletDescription:portletHandle";
52: public static final String EBXML_WSRP_PORTLET_MARKUP_TYPES = "urn:oasis:names:tc:wsrp:PortletDescription:markupType";
53: public static final String EBXML_WSRP_HAS_PORTLET_ASSOCIATION = "urn:oasis:names:tc:wsrp:pfb:ebxml:registry:associationType:HasPortlet";
54: }
|